Kentucky U.S. Attorney: Former State Employee Charged With Mail Fraud, Identity Theft and Theft of Funds
August 02, 2019
LEXINGTON, Kentucky, Aug. 2 -- The office of the U.S. Attorney for the Eastern District of Kentucky issued the following news release:

A Federal grand jury sitting in Lexington has indicted a former employee of the Kentucky Commission (now Office) for Children With Special Health Care Needs, on charges arising from allegations of theft from that agency.
